Nigerian Afrobeats star Davido (David Adeleke) has revealed that he is stepping away from the ongoing custody proceedings concerning his daughter, Imade, while expressing dissatisfaction with how events unfolded in court.
In a statement posted on X late Friday, the singer dismissed claims that he had pursued full custody of his child. He clarified that his legal request was for joint custody, not sole guardianship.
“I never asked for full custody … I asked for joint custody. Nobody won, nobody lost but Imade … so I don’t know why some pple r celebrating. There’s nothing to celebrate,” he wrote.
Davido explained that he decided to discontinue the case after what he described as an unacceptable development during the hearing. According to him, his late son was mentioned during proceedings something he said deeply upset him.
“I’ve decided to drop the case because … until she brought out her last card! MY DECEASED SON! THAT’S A NO NO! Lowest blow!” he stated.
He emphasized that his involvement in the legal matter was motivated by love and a sense of responsibility toward his daughter, adding that one day she would understand his efforts.
“My daughter will grow up knowing I fought for her … let’s move on. One love!” he added.
The singer also addressed the issue on his Instagram story, where he criticised the opposing counsel’s conduct, accusing them of behaving unprofessionally during the session.
“I disgraced you in the courtroom … I was teaching you your work … and then went on to mention my son. Like I said in the courtroom, I pray you never go through what me and my wife have gone through ever,” he wrote.
His comments came after Lagos-based lawyer Maruf Muhammed shared updates online about tense exchanges at the Lagos State High Court in Yaba.
“Davido in High Court, Yaba now! Come and see drama in court. The lawyer made 001 lose his patience during cross-examination o! Be you never so high, the law is above you,” Muhammed posted.
When asked about the case, it was clarified that the court session concerned custody arrangements for Imade.
Recently, Imade was seen spending time with her father after winning a talent competition a moment that excited fans and highlighted both parents’ continued involvement in her life.
The custody matter between Davido and Imade’s mother has continued to attract public attention, with many supporters urging both parties to prioritise peaceful co-parenting moving forward.
